C windows form validating event

Rated 3.92/5 based on 866 customer reviews

In this case, I think the simplest solution is to validate these textboxes in the Save button's Click event handler, instead of validating the textboxes in their Validating event handler. None" above prevents the dialog box from closing & returning Dialog Result. Here's my code | | Private Sub Save() | For each c as control in Me.

Of course, you could include the code of validating these textboxes in a function and call this function in the Save button's Click event handler. If you have anything unclear, please feel free to let me know. None Exit For End If End If Next End Sub NOTE: This loop probably should be recursive to get controls within container controls, within other container controls...

The only way I've found to dothis is to cycle through every control and call it's . This is clunky though because you can see a flash in each text box as it'sbeing validated. Select() End if Next c End Sub Each control has code in their Control_Validating event that fires off an errorprovider. Here's my code Private Sub Save() For each c as control in Me. Click If Not Validate Children() Then Dialog Result = Windows. In this section, you will see examples of events in use.Here's my code Private Sub Save() For each c as control in Me. (It doesn't cost anything extra.) Private Declare Function Lock Window Update Lib "user32" (By Val hwnd As Long) As Long Lock Window Update(Me. Select() End if Next c End Sub Each control has code in their Control_Validating event that fires off an errorprovider.

Leave a Reply